In certain scenarios, such as instances where you are found not guilty, a criminal defense attorney can assist you expunge your record after two or three years. Expungement deletes your rap sheet, restoring you to the standing you had before the crime. Your lawyer can advise you on how to manage the scenario and guarantee that you don't mistakenly incriminate on your own. Under Florida Laws § 901.17, you can remain silent and the right to an attorney. This implies you don't have to answer inquiries concerning your case up until your legal representative exists. It's vital to work out these rights and prevent speaking with police without lawful advice.
